find the length of side x. round to the nearest tenth.
triangle with angles 45°, 75°, and side 9, side x
x =
question help:
Step1: Find the third angle
The sum of angles in a triangle is \(180^\circ\). So the third angle \(A = 180^\circ - 75^\circ - 45^\circ = 60^\circ\).
Step2: Apply the Law of Sines
The Law of Sines states \(\frac{x}{\sin(45^\circ)}=\frac{9}{\sin(60^\circ)}\).
Solve for \(x\): \(x=\frac{9\times\sin(45^\circ)}{\sin(60^\circ)}\).
Calculate \(\sin(45^\circ)=\frac{\sqrt{2}}{2}\approx0.7071\), \(\sin(60^\circ)=\frac{\sqrt{3}}{2}\approx0.8660\).
Then \(x=\frac{9\times0.7071}{0.8660}\approx\frac{6.3639}{0.8660}\approx7.3\).
